      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;Why giving up your phone number can mean giving up your privacy&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;Forget divorce or the dissolution of a business partnership.&amp;nbsp;In 2017, your most unpredictable, time-consuming and financially perilous breakup may be with your old phone number.&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;Surrendering your digits can be more problematic than losing your phone. On most smartphones, a quick security wipe can remove all personal data&amp;nbsp;—&amp;nbsp;and it can even be done&amp;nbsp;remotely if your phone is lost or stolen. But give up your phone number and the burden is on you to find every business, person and entity that links that number to your life —&amp;nbsp;your finances, medical records, email or social media accounts, business contacts, and much more — and remove it&amp;nbsp;at each place.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;If you miss any, your life can become an open book for whoever gets assigned your old number.&amp;nbsp;This stranger could receive texts, photos and voicemails meant for you, and even the&amp;nbsp;temporary passcodes&amp;nbsp;you need&amp;nbsp;to log in to your secure accounts.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;More:&amp;nbsp; &lt;A href="http://www.latimes.com/business/la-fi-tn-phone-number-security-20161125-story.html" target="_blank"&gt;http://www.latimes.com/business/la-fi-tn-phone-number-security-20161125-story.html&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
